FundingInstant‑delivery veteran Gopuff has raised $250 million in fresh funding at a reduced $8.5 billion valuation, as the company doubles down on turning rapid convenience delivery into a durable, profitable business.2025-11-13

Problems · theme 01
Electrified Fleet Planning Challenges
26 papers · 37.7% of this block
▼ -63% share2022→2025 share of research on this subject
Researchers highlight difficulties in optimizing electric vehicle fleet operations and estimating fuel consumption for shared mobility services.
